Welcome to the SHOP! MARKETING AWARDS 2026
The SHOP! MARKETING AWARDS, organized by the SHOP! East Asia Cooperation Organization (SHOP!eaco), is an internationally recognized accolade in the field of retail marketing. As a core pillar of the SHOP! AWARDS, it has been celebrating outstanding retail marketing campaigns worldwide since the association's founding in 1936, earning a reputation as a benchmark in the retail marketing industry.
In 2026, the SHOP! MARKETING AWARDS continues to welcome submissions from global retailers, retail brands, advertising agencies, brand planning firms, retail design companies, retail technology companies, retail service providers, and retail prop manufacturers. We invite exceptional retail marketing campaigns to join us in driving the deep integration of marketing practices with consumer experiences, leading the way toward a sustainable retail market.
Whether it's digital marketing, integrated communications, experiential campaigns, user engagement strategies, or innovative retail technology applications — the SHOP! MARKETING AWARDS looks forward to celebrating every marketing case that drives consumer connection and creates measurable business value.

JUDGING CRITERIA(REGULAR)
The SHOP! MARKETING AWARDS Jury Panel will evaluate all entries against the SHOP! AWARDS criteria across seven core dimensions:
Design, Production, Expression, Innovation, Effectiveness, Engagement, Impact.
Design
The visual expression and creative presentation of the marketing campaign. We evaluate the uniqueness, aesthetic quality, and brand recognition of the overall visual language. Excellent design should capture the target audience's attention at first glance and effectively deliver marketing messages through compelling visual communication.
Production
The execution quality of marketing materials and delivery vehicles. Whether physical props, digital content, or technology systems, we assess the craftsmanship, technical implementation standards, and fidelity to the original creative vision. Superior production execution is the key bridge that brings marketing ideas from paper to reality.
Expression
The narrative power and communication effectiveness of marketing messages. We evaluate whether the campaign clearly and powerfully conveys core brand values and propositions to consumers. Outstanding expression should evoke emotional resonance, enabling consumers to connect with and remember the message.
Innovation
Breakthroughs in marketing thinking and execution methods. We encourage new approaches that go beyond industry conventions in strategy, media, technology, or interactive formats. Innovation does not necessarily mean "never seen before" — rather, it creates new consumer touchpoints or interactive experiences in specific contexts.
Effectiveness
The degree to which the marketing campaign achieves its intended goals. We evaluate actual performance in areas such as reach, brand awareness lift, user engagement, and word-of-mouth spread. Effectiveness is the most direct measure of marketing value.
Engagement
The depth of interaction between consumers and marketing content. We assess whether the campaign successfully motivates active consumer participation, including click-throughs, social sharing, user-generated content, or offline store visits. Deep engagement often signifies stronger brand relationships.
Impact
The tangible contribution of the marketing campaign to business outcomes. We evaluate overall performance in sales conversion, customer acquisition, repeat purchase rates, or market share growth. Sustainable impact is the fundamental reason a marketing campaign earns long-term market recognition.
